Transaction 890d336d72c867e50a5786ecbad43b105232266eb704e844fa44f5e3162e2dc5

1 Input
2 Outputs
  • 890d336d72c867e50a5786ecbad43b105232266eb704e844fa44f5e3162e2dc5:0
  • value  11525035930
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 890d336d72c867e50a5786ecbad43b105232266eb704e844fa44f5e3162e2dc5:1
  • value  45754516
    address  1F8xyb8k2LSi944SCHzJhZ2dyHQiLQVVJr